I'd be cautious on that survey. Correct me if I am wrong but it was commissioned by Ancestry.com for publicity, based on results from their commercial present day population, during a period when Ancestry.com didn't seem to understand the differences between Britain and England judging on the labels they were applying those days. Then sensationalised in the Daily Mail tabloid. Ancestry have made a lot of improvements since then.  No AncientDNA was used. But I do love the suggestion that East Yorkshire appears very Danish, and East Anglia more Dutch. The Dutch link continued through the Medieval and into the Post Medieval as the Strangers.

My technique, which may only apply to New World and other mixed pop members, is to look at the modern average and individual 2 ways for combos that include known ancestry, or population substitutes for known ancesetry.

While I do have some German, a little bit of Irish, and a minuscule amount of Dutch Danish, Norwegian, Swedish, Finn, French (no known Icelandic), the bulk of it is English, Scottish/Ulster Scot, and Welsh

As far as population substitutes, in my case
Danes are probably most similar to Yorkshire/East Midlands English,
Dutch are probably more similar to the Rest of Eastern and south eastern England e.g. East Anglia and other predominately Saxon areas of England
Scotland is going to be more similar to northern England e.g. Durham, Northumbria, and Cumbria.

The Irish cover such a large area on PCAs that it's hard to nail them down...maybe generic pre Saxon Britons & Irish.  I'm gonna skip them and the Icelandics in the possible interpretations below.

In my case of these Modern scaled averages might be interpreting my mostly English ancestry as:
0.01498 Mitchell_scaled = 66% Scotland + 34% Denmark (possibly 66% Scottish/Northern English, 34% Yorkshire/East Midlands)
0.01518 Mitchell_scaled = 61% Scotland + 39% Holland (61% Scottish/North English, 39% East Anglia, southeastern England)
0.0157 Mitchell_scaled = 60% Holland + 40% Denmark (60% East Anglia and SE England, 40% Yorkshire & East Midlands)
0.01604 Mitchell_scaled = 59% Denmark + 41% England (59% Yorkshire & East Midlands, 41% rest of Britain and Ireland)

On the individual moderns,
0.01100 51% English:England7 + 49% Danish:436.  Possibly 51% Scottish/Northern England, 49% Yorkshire and East Midlands
0.01270 61% Scottish:Scottish24 + 39% Dutch:Netherlands56. Possibly 61% Scottish and Northern English, 39% East Anglia and SE England

Not an exact science, as my English ancestry wasn't limited to North Sea facing England, but if you know you don't have ancestry from some of these modern 2 way countries, then it's just a way to try make more sense of the results.
